Lotus F1 Team Makes The Slowest Mall Chase Video Ever
The Dubai Mall is the world's largest shopping mall, so Renault let Lotus Formula One team drivers Romain Grosjean and Pastor Maldonado loose inside in a pair of Renault Twizys. Yes, in fact, a Twizy will powerslide.
Everyone loves a good gratuitous-use-of-F1-drivers promotional video (exception: Kimi Räikkönen) and just before the end of the season is when Formula One teams like to let many of their drivers loose for some fun.
The Twizy is a cute little rear-wheel-drive electric city car with a chassis signed off on by RenaultSport themselves. Its electric motor only produces 17 horsepower, but it's lightweight and stiff enough that it can easily break the tail end loose.
Autocar previously tested the Twizy's driftability in a simple outdoor test, but seeing these cute little machines fishtail through an active shopping mall is far more adorable.
If perfectly polished mega-mall floors weren't enough help with getting the back end to step out, Grosjean gets stuck on an ice rink for good measure.
